Those who were possessed by demons in Scripture showed certain symptoms. They include the following:

Cannot Control Themselves
A person who is under the control of a demon cannot control themselves. The evil spirit is able to speak through their lips or can make them mute as it so desires. Scripture gives examples of demon-possessed people who were mute.
And when the demon was cast out, the mute man spoke: and the multitudes marveled, saying, It was never so seen in Israel (Matthew 9:33).

Then was brought unto Him one possessed with a demon, blind and mute: and He healed him, insomuch that the mute man spoke and saw (Matthew 12:22).

We also find demons speaking through people.
Just then there was in their synagogue a man with an unclean spirit, and he cried out, "What have You to do with us, Jesus of Nazareth? Have You come to destroy us? I know who You are, the Holy One of God" (Mark 1:23-24).
New Personality

Demon-possession means that a new personality is introduced to that person - the victim becomes a different person. The Gadarene demoniac acted and spoke as one who was controlled by another personality
Suddenly they shouted, "What have you to do with us, Son of God? Have you come here to torment us before the time?" (Matthew 8:29).

Different Voice
Sometimes those who are demon-possessed speak with a different voice. On one occasion, when Jesus asked the name of the demon, the demon spoke through the man and said:

And He asked him, What is your name? And he said unto Him, My name is Legion; for we are many (Mark 5:9).
4. Supernatural Knowledge

In one incident, the demons speaking through a man, immediately recognized Jesus as the Messiah.
Just then there was in their synagogue a man with an unclean spirit, and he cried out, "What have You to do with us, Jesus of Nazareth? Have You come to destroy us? I know who You are, the Holy One of God" (Mark 1:23-24).

This understanding of Jesus' identity came from supernatural knowledge. For at this time, Jesus had not yet revealed Himself to His disciples, or to the world, as the promised Messiah.


New Abilities
A person who is demon-possessed acquires new abilities. For example, those possessed by demons can demonstrate superhuman strength. The Bible speaks of one demoniac in the following way.
He had often been restrained with shackles and chains, but the chains he wrenched apart, and the shackles he broke in pieces; and no one had the strength to subdue him. Night and day among the tombs and on the mountains he was always howling and bruising himself with stones (Mark 5:4,5).

Suicidal Tendencies
Demon possession can lead to suicidal tendencies. The Bible says of one person who was demon-possessed.
It has often cast him into the fire and into the water, to destroy him; but if you are able to do anything, have pity on us and help us (Mark 9:22).

It seems that demons want to physically destroy the person they possess.

The New Testament tells us some of the signs of demon possession The demons are able to speak through their victims, they can demonstrate new abilities, show different personalities, and exhibit suicidal tendencies.
